Job Summary

The Senior Project Engineering Manager will operate under the direction of the Americas Pole Leader for Project Engineering Management. This role is responsible for executing the engineering portion of OTR contracts that include Balance of Plant (BOP) scope.

You will own project control activities globally and drive consistent functional specifications and standardized processes for project implementation. The position impacts project quality, efficiency, and effectiveness across teams, requiring sound professional judgment and operational autonomy. Occasional travel within the U.S., Latin America, and internationally is required.


Roles and Responsibilities

  • Serve as the technical leader and manager to develop scope of work, scheduling plans, and oversight of engineering activities for customer projects.

  • Provide technical leadership and interface with proposal management, cost estimating, partners, customers, product engineering, sourcing, and subcontracted engineering teams.

  • Develop specialized knowledge in your discipline and serve as a best-practice and quality resource.

  • Contribute to strategy and policy development to ensure project delivery within your area of responsibility.

  • Apply in-depth knowledge of best practices, competitive factors, and industry standards to guide decision-making.

  • Use technical expertise and data analysis to support operational and engineering recommendations.

  • Lead small to medium-sized projects with moderate risks and resource requirements.

  • Communicate complex or sensitive information clearly to build consensus and influence stakeholders.

  • Own the engineering execution of BOP-scoped projects from contract signature to the completion of contractual obligations.

  • Manage a cross-functional engineering team to identify and mitigate project risks and maximize opportunities.

  • Provide technical guidance and support to project management and internal engineering teams.

  • Review customer specifications and communicate requirements to design teams through internal documentation systems.

  • Evaluate the financial and scheduling impacts of customer-requested scope changes.

  • Provide technical support to engineering, sourcing, vendors, and installation teams to ensure compliance with customer and business objectives.

  • Enforce quality procedures and contribute to their continuous improvement.

  • Capture and document lessons learned to ensure organizational knowledge retention.

  • Work collaboratively within a matrix organization that includes engineering teams, project managers, quality, sourcing, logistics, and scheduling.

  • Serve as Senior Project Engineering Manager to lead cross-product technical integration, ensuring alignment across all project lines (GT/ST/Gen/BOP).

  • Partner with project managers for customer and EPC meetings, driving resolution of technical issues and ensuring compliance with contractual obligations.

  • Manage technical risks and project profitability within assigned budgets.
